  • Anty-bribery management system

    Anty-bribery management system

    ISO 37001 is designed to help your organization implement an anti-bribery management system or enhance the controls you currently have. It requires implementing a series of measures such as:

    • adopting an anti-bribery policy;
    • appointing someone to oversee compliance with that policy, vetting and training employees;
    • undertaking risk assessments on projects and business associates;
    • implementing financial and commercial controls;
    • instituting reporting and investigation procedures.
    Implementing an anti-bribery management system requires leadership and input from top management, and the policy and program must be communicated to all staff and external parties such as contractors, suppliers and joint venture partners.
    In this way, it helps to reduce the risk of bribery occurring and can demonstrate to your management, employees, owners, funders, customers and other business associates that you have put in place internationally recognized good-practice anti-bribery controls. It can also provide evidence in the event of a criminal investigation that you have taken reasonable steps to prevent bribery.

    What is an anti-bribery management system?

    An anti-bribery management system is designed to impose an anti-bribery culture in an organization and to implement appropriate controls, which will increase the chance of detecting bribery and reducing its incidence.

    The anti-bribery management system, which is based on a number of measures and means of control, including support guidelines, specifies requirements on the following aspects:

    • Anti-bribery policy and procedures;
    • Management leadership, commitment and responsibility;
    • Training in the spirit of fighting bribery;
    • Designation of a person to oversee compliance with this policy;
    • Due diligence on projects and business associates;
    • Financial, commercial and contractual controls, as well as in the field of acquisitions;
    • Reporting, monitoring, investigation and review actions, as well as audits;
    • Corrective actions and continual improvement.

    Why certification?

    ISO 22301, the world’s first international standard for Business Continuity Management (BCM), has been developed to help organizations minimize the risk of such disruptions. This standard will replace the current British standard BS 25999.

    ISO 22301 was developed so that compatibility with other management systems like ISO 9001 (quality management), ISO 14001 (environmental management) and ISO/IEC 27001 (information security management) etc. can be ensured, and this led to some differences of terminology by comparison to BS 25999-2.

    Who should implement ISO/IEC 27701?

    ISO/IEC 27701 has been designed to be used by all data controllers and data processors. Like ISO 27001, it supports a risk-based approach, so that each organization addresses the specific risks it faces, as well as the risks both for personal data and for the integrity and confidentiality of this data.

     

    About ISO/IEC 27701

    ISO/IEC 27701:2021 – Security Techniques. Extension to ISO/IEC 27001 and ISO/IEC 27002 for the management of privacy information. Requirements and Guidelines
    The standard is an extension of ISO 27001 on data privacy and provides guidance for organizations that want to implement systems that support GDPR compliance and other data privacy requirements, allowing organizations to evaluate, treat and reduce the risks associated with the collection, maintenance and processing of personal information.
    The standard defines the requirements for an information security management system adapted to protect personal data, called the Privacy Information Management System, in short PIMS.
